How to Make the Perfect Chocolate Hazelnut Crunch Cookies
Ingredients
To create these delightful Chocolate Hazelnut Crunch Cookies, you’ll need a handful of simple yet essential ingredients. Each one plays a vital role in achieving that perfect balance of flavor and texture:
- 1 cup all-purpose flour: This forms the base of your cookies, providing structure.
- 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der: For that rich chocolate flavor that makes these cookies irresistible.
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da: This helps the cookies rise and become light and airy.
- 1/4 teaspoon salt: A pinch of salt enhances the sweetness and balances the flavors.
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ened: Adds richness and moisture to the cookies.
- 1 cup granulated sugar: Sweetens the cookies and contributes to their chewy texture.
- 1/2 cup brown sugar: For a deeper flavor and added moisture.
- 1 large egg: Binds the ingredients together and adds richness.
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ract: A must-have for that warm, comforting aroma.
- 1 cup chopped hazelnuts: The star ingredient that gives these cookies their delightful crunch.
- 1 cup chocolate chips: Because more chocolate is always a good idea!
If you’re not a fan of hazelnuts, feel free to substitute them with walnuts or pecans for a different twist. You can also add a sprinkle of sea salt on top before baking for an extra flavor boost.
Step-by-Step Instructions
Now that you have your ingredients ready, let’s dive into the process of making these scrumptious cookies. Follow these steps for the best results:
- Preheat your oven: Set it to 350°F (175°C) to ensure your cookies bake evenly.
- Mix the dry ingredients: In a b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t until well combined.
- Cream the butter and sugars: In another bowl, cream together the softened but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y. This step is crucial for achieving that perfect cookie texture.
- Add the egg and vanilla: Mix in the egg and vanilla extract until fully incorporated.
- Combine wet and dry ingredients: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can lead to tough cookies.
- Fold in the goodies: Gently fold in the chopped hazelnuts and chocolate chips, ensuring they are evenly distributed throughout the dough.
- Shape the cookies: Drop spoonfuls of dough on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per, leaving enough space between each cookie for spreading.
- Bake: Place the baking sheet in the oven and b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are set but the centers are still soft.
- Cool: Let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Top Tips for Perfecting Your Chocolate Hazelnut Crunch Cookies
To ensure your Chocolate Hazelnut Crunch Cookies turn out perfectly every time, I’ve gathered some expert techniques and cooking hacks that will elevate your baking game. These tips not only enhance the flavor and texture of your cookies but also add a touch of cultural flair to your baking experience:
- Use Room Temperature Ingredients: Make sure your butter and egg are at room temperature before you start mixing. This helps create a smooth batter and ensures even mixing, resulting in a better texture.
- Measure Flour Correctly: Spoon the flour into your measuring cup and level it off with a knife. Avoid scooping directly from the bag, as this can lead to packed flour and dry cookies. Accurate measurements are key to achieving the perfect cookie consistency.
- Chill the Dough: After mixing, chill your cookie dough for at least 30 minutes. This step helps the flavors meld and prevents the cookies from spreading too much while baking, resulting in thicker, chewier cookies.
- Experiment with Nut Toasting: Toasting your hazelnuts before adding them to the dough can enhance their flavor significantly. Simply spread them on a baking sheet and toast in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10 minutes, or until fragrant. This simple step adds a depth of flavor that will make your cookies stand out.
- Use a Silpat or Parchment Paper: Line your baking sheets with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at (Silpat) to prevent sticking and ensure even baking. This also makes cleanup a breeze!
- Rotate Your Baking Sheets: If you’re baking multiple trays at once, rotate them halfway through the baking time. This ensures even cooking, especially if your oven has hot spots.
- Don’t Overbake: Keep a close eye on your cookies as they bake. They should be set around the edges but still soft in the center. They will continue to firm up as they cool, so it’s better to underbake slightly than to overbake.
- Garnish with Sea Salt: For a gourmet touch, sprinkle a pinch of flaky sea salt on top of the cookies right after they come out of the oven. The salt enhances the sweetness and adds a delightful contrast to the rich chocolate.

Storing and Reheating Tips
Once you’ve baked a batch of Chocolate Hazelnut Crunch Cookies, you’ll want to ensure they stay fresh and delicious for as long as possible. Here are some practical tips for storing and reheating your cookies:
Storing Your Cookies
- Room Temperature: If you plan to enjoy your cookies within a week, store them in an airtight container at room temperature. This keeps them soft and chewy, allowing you to savor their delightful texture.
- Refrigeration: For longer storage, you can refrigerate your cookies. Place them in an airtight container with parchment paper between layers to prevent sticking. They can last up to two weeks in the fridge, but be aware that refrigeration may slightly alter their texture.
- Freezing: To keep your cookies fresh for an extended period, freezing is the best option. Place the cooled cookies in a single layer on a baking sheet and freeze until solid. Then, transfer them to a freezer-safe bag or container, separating layers with parchment paper. They can be stored in the freezer for up to three months.
Reheating Your Cookies
When you’re ready to enjoy your stored cookies, reheating them can bring back that fresh-baked taste:
- Oven Method: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Place the cookies on a baking sheet and heat for about 5-7 minutes, or until warmed through. This method helps restore their original texture and flavor.
- Microwave Method: If you’re in a hurry, you can use the microwave. Place a cookie on a microwave-safe plate and heat for about 10-15 seconds. Be cautious not to overheat, as this can make the cookies tough.
- Toaster Oven: For a quick and efficient reheating option, a toaster oven works wonders. Set it to 350°F (175°C) and heat the cookies for about 5 minutes, ensuring they stay soft and delicious.

Helpful Notes
As you embark on your journey to create the perfect Chocolate Hazelnut Crunch Cookies, here are some extra clarifications and tips to ensure your baking experience is smooth and enjoyable:
Ingredient Prep
- Butter: Make sure your unsalted butter is softened to room temperature before creaming it with the sugars. This helps achieve a light and fluffy texture, which is essential for the cookies.
- Hazelnuts: If you’re using whole hazelnuts, toast them lightly in a dry skillet over medium heat for about 5-7 minutes, stirring frequently. This enhances their flavor and aroma, making your cookies even more delicious.
- Cocoa Powder: For the best flavor, use high-quality unsweetened cocoa powder. Dutch-processed cocoa can also be used for a smoother taste, but it may alter the color of your cookies slightly.
Potential Substitutions
- Nut Alternatives: If you’re allergic to hazelnuts or simply prefer a different nut, walnuts or pecans can be excellent substitutes. They provide a similar crunch and flavor profile.
- Flour Options: For a gluten-free version, you can subst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end. Just ensure it contains xanthan gum for proper texture.
- Sweetener Swaps: If you want to reduce sugar, consider using coconut sugar or a sugar substitute like erythritol. Just keep in mind that this may affect the texture and sweetness level.

FAQs About Chocolate Hazelnut Crunch Cookies
Can I use other nuts instead of hazelnuts?
Yes, you can substitute hazelnuts with walnuts, pecans, or even almonds if you prefer. Each nut will bring its own unique flavor and texture to the cookies.
Are these cookies suitable for people with diabetes?
It depends. You can use sugar substitutes like stevia or erythritol to make them more diabetes-friendly. However, always consult with a healthcare professional for personalized advice.
Can I freeze the cookie dough?
Yes, you can freeze the cookie dough! Just scoop the dough onto a baking sheet, freeze until solid,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ag. When you’re ready to bake, simply bake from frozen, adding a couple of extra minutes to the baking time.
How long do these cookies stay fresh?
These Chocolate Hazelnut Crunch Cookies can stay fresh for up to a week when stored in an airtight container at room temperature. For longer storage, consider freezing them.

Print
Chocolate Hazelnut Crunch Cookies
- Total Time: 27 minutes
- Yield: 24 cookies 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
Deliciously crunchy cookies packed with chocolate and hazelnuts.
Ingredients
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1 large egg
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up chopped hazelnuts
- 1 cup chocolate chips
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a bowl, whisk together fl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t.
- In another bowl, cream together the but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until light and fluffy.
- Add the egg and vanilla extract to the butter mixture and mix well.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
- Fold in the chopped hazelnuts and chocolate chips.
- Drop spoonfuls of dough on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- Bake for 10-12 minutes or until the edges are set.
- Let c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
